Nomad is a cluster manager, designed for both long lived services and short lived batch processing workloads. Developers use a declarative job specification to submit work, and Nomad ensures constraints are satisfied and resource utilization is optimized by efficient task packing. Nomad supports all major operating systems and virtualized, containerized, or standalone applications.

Eclipse GlassFish is a lightweight yet powerful open-source application server that fully implements the Jakarta EE platform. Designed for flexibility, scalability, and reliability, it provides a production-ready environment that adheres strictly to open standards without proprietary dependencies. GlassFish delivers comprehensive support for all required and optional Jakarta EE APIs, successfully passing all corresponding Technology Compatibility Kits (TCKs). It includes an advanced administration console, clustering capabilities, and a rich set of tools that streamline both development and deployment. Continuously maintained under the Eclipse Foundation, GlassFish remains a robust and standards-compliant choice for modern enterprise applications.

Apache Aurora is a service scheduler that runs on top of Mesos, enabling you to run long-running services that take advantage of Mesos' scalability, fault-tolerance, and resource isolation.
